What was the name of the hall in which beowulf and grendel battled?

Heorot was the name of the hall in which Beowulf and Grendel battled.

It was the mead-hall described by the writer as 
"the foremost of halls under heaven". This hall was dedicated for the king.
The name "
Heorot" actually means "The hall of the hart".
